When deciding how to deploy changes to a FlexCard, which scenario best justifies versioning instead of cloning?

Study for the OmniStudio Developer Test. Focus with flashcards and multiple-choice questions, each with hints and explanations. Get ready for your exam!

Multiple Choice

When deciding how to deploy changes to a FlexCard, which scenario best justifies versioning instead of cloning?

Explanation:
Versioning lets you create a new version of the same FlexCard and deploy that version separately from the one already in use. This is ideal when you want to ship changes to a new Console while keeping the current Console running the existing version, so the old behavior remains unchanged and risk is minimized during the rollout. In this scenario, the new version will be used in a new Console and the current version should stay untouched. That exactly aligns with the purpose of versioning: isolate the new work from the existing card and control where and when the new version is active. Cloning creates a separate card copy rather than a new version of the same card, which is more about duplicating for independent use rather than preserving and evolving a single card across targets. The other situations describe either showing two variants on the same target or updating all instances, which don’t leverage the versioning approach as cleanly for this purpose.

Versioning lets you create a new version of the same FlexCard and deploy that version separately from the one already in use. This is ideal when you want to ship changes to a new Console while keeping the current Console running the existing version, so the old behavior remains unchanged and risk is minimized during the rollout.

In this scenario, the new version will be used in a new Console and the current version should stay untouched. That exactly aligns with the purpose of versioning: isolate the new work from the existing card and control where and when the new version is active. Cloning creates a separate card copy rather than a new version of the same card, which is more about duplicating for independent use rather than preserving and evolving a single card across targets. The other situations describe either showing two variants on the same target or updating all instances, which don’t leverage the versioning approach as cleanly for this purpose.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y